Plantillas de gráficos personalizados

Plantilla de gráfico personalizada

En el mundo de la visualización de datos, que está en constante evolución, es fundamental crear plantillas de gráficos personalizadas para transmitir la historia de los datos de manera eficaz. Aspose.Cells para Java ofrece un potente conjunto de herramientas para generar gráficos dinámicos y personalizados en aplicaciones Java. En esta guía paso a paso, exploraremos cómo aprovechar las capacidades de Aspose.Cells para Java para crear impresionantes plantillas de gráficos personalizadas. ¡Vamos a profundizar!

Entendiendo Aspose.Cells para Java

Antes de comenzar a crear plantillas de gráficos personalizadas, familiaricémonos con Aspose.Cells para Java. Es una API diseñada para manipular archivos de Excel en aplicaciones Java. Con sus amplias funciones, le permite trabajar con hojas de cálculo, gráficos y más de Excel de manera programática.

Prerrequisitos

Para seguir este tutorial, asegúrese de tener los siguientes requisitos previos:

  • Java Development Kit (JDK) instalado en su sistema.
  • Biblioteca Aspose.Cells para Java. Puedes descargarla desdeaquí.

Creación de una plantilla de gráfico personalizada

Paso 1: Configuración del proyecto

Comience por crear un nuevo proyecto Java en su entorno de desarrollo integrado (IDE) preferido. Asegúrese de agregar la biblioteca Aspose.Cells para Java a las dependencias de su proyecto.

Paso 2: Inicialización de Aspose.Cells

En su aplicación Java, inicialice Aspose.Cells de la siguiente manera:

import com.aspose.cells.Workbook;

public class ChartTemplateExample {
    public static void main(String[] args) {
        // Cargar el libro de Excel
        Workbook workbook = new Workbook();

        // Tu código aquí

        // Guardar el libro de trabajo
        workbook.save("CustomChartTemplate.xlsx");
    }
}

Paso 3: Agregar datos

Antes de crear un gráfico, necesita datos. Puede importarlos de una fuente existente o generarlos mediante programación. Para este ejemplo, generaremos datos de muestra:

// Agregar datos a una hoja de cálculo
int sheetIndex = workbook.getWorksheets().add();
Worksheet worksheet = workbook.getWorksheets().get(sheetIndex);

// Su código de población de datos aquí

Paso 4: Crear un gráfico

Ahora, vamos a crear un gráfico y personalizarlo según tus necesidades. Puedes elegir entre varios tipos de gráficos, como gráficos de barras, gráficos de líneas, gráficos circulares y más. A continuación, se muestra un ejemplo de cómo crear un gráfico de barras:

// Agregar un gráfico a la hoja de trabajo
int chartIndex = worksheet.getCharts().add(ChartType.BAR, 5, 0, 15, 5);
Chart chart = worksheet.getCharts().get(chartIndex);

// Tu código de personalización de gráficos aquí

Paso 5: Aplicación de plantillas personalizadas

Aspose.Cells para Java le permite aplicar plantillas personalizadas a sus gráficos. Puede definir la apariencia, los colores, las etiquetas y más del gráfico. A continuación, se muestra un ejemplo de aplicación de una plantilla personalizada:

// Cargar una plantilla de gráfico personalizada
chart.getChartArea().setArea.Formatting = ChartAreaFormattingType.Custom;
chart.getChartArea().setArea.Custom = "path/to/custom-template.xml";

Paso 6: Guardar el gráfico

Una vez que su gráfico esté listo, guárdelo en un archivo Excel:

// Guardar el libro de trabajo con el gráfico
workbook.save("CustomChartTemplate.xlsx");

Conclusión

La creación de plantillas de gráficos personalizadas con Aspose.Cells para Java le permite diseñar gráficos visualmente atractivos e informativos adaptados a sus requisitos específicos. Ya sea que esté creando informes financieros, paneles o presentaciones basadas en datos, Aspose.Cells le brinda la flexibilidad y el control que necesita.

Preguntas frecuentes

¿Cómo puedo instalar Aspose.Cells para Java?

Para instalar Aspose.Cells para Java, visite la página de descargaaquíDescargue la biblioteca y siga las instrucciones de instalación proporcionadas en la documentación.

¿Qué tipos de gráficos puedo crear con Aspose.Cells para Java?

Aspose.Cells para Java admite una amplia variedad de tipos de gráficos, incluidos gráficos de barras, gráficos de líneas, gráficos de dispersión, gráficos circulares y más. Puede personalizar estos gráficos para que se adapten a sus necesidades de visualización de datos.

¿Puedo aplicar temas personalizados a mis gráficos?

Sí, puede aplicar temas y plantillas personalizados a sus gráficos en Aspose.Cells para Java. Esto le permite mantener una apariencia uniforme en todos sus gráficos e informes.

¿Aspose.Cells para Java es adecuado tanto para datos simples como complejos?

¡Por supuesto! Aspose.Cells para Java es versátil y puede manejar escenarios de datos tanto simples como complejos. Ya sea que trabaje con conjuntos de datos básicos o modelos financieros complejos, Aspose.Cells lo tiene cubierto.

¿Dónde puedo encontrar más recursos y documentación?

Para obtener documentación y ejemplos completos, visite la documentación de Aspose.Cells para Java enaquí.